Rapper Jay-Z is plotting his return to Glastonbury.He ruled out playing at the Somerset event, saying: 'Not next year though...this year was too big'.It was one the most talked about headline performances the festival has ever seen.It sparked debate, and even a few doubters - Noel Gallagher claimed the hip-hop star was wrong for the Glastonbury.But opening on the Pyramid stage in front of around 80,000 music lovers, Jay responded to the criticism by playing the Oasis track Wonderwall.As a result there has been a surge in sales of Wonderwall which was first released in 1995.
